In what appears to be a send-up of two popular Quentin Tarantino films, "Reservoir Dogs" and "Pulp Fiction," with a nod also to The Sopranos, CAO Films presents "Mission Escaparate." The plot centers around a caper organized by "Mr. Huge" (played by Fred Gill) to steal a new
blend from CAO's Escaparate - the vault "that safeguards every cigar that comes from the CAO factories." Mr. Huge wants the blend before CAO can debut it at this summer's IPCPR trade show in Las Vegas. Mystery and intrigue ensue.
Presented in two parts on CAO's YouTube channel, the movie also stars several CAO staff members including Jon Huber (Director of Lifestyle Marketing) as "Johnny Chaos." Along with some gun-totin' tough guys, there are also several comely young ladies in the movie. Plus, you'll get a sneak peak at CAO International's corporate offices in Nashville, including their warehouse, and of course, the coveted Escaparate.
Will it win a "Palme d'Or" at Cannes? Probably not, but it's fun to watch.
